Давайте откроем скобки в предложениях, используя соответствующее будущее время. Я объясню, как мы определяем, какое время использовать в каждом случае.
- You will have to stay at home until you get rid of your bad cough.
- According to the weather forecast, snow will fall by the end of December.
- Autumn has come. The trees will lose their leaves in a few weeks.
- They will not go to the football match tomorrow, because they will be working at that time.
- He told me that when he has been in Japan for five years, he will write a book.
- By the time you get back, Simon will have left.
- Please, don't wear indoor shoes in the gymnasium, or you will damage the floor.
- What would you say if you saw her?
- The Stones will have been married for thirty years in May.
- I have to be back at 3.30, so I will leave before lunch.
- By the end of the month she will have worked in this company for three years.
- Why don't you come with us? We are going to have a lot of fun.
- I am taking my exams on Monday, so I think I will stay in on Saturday night.
- The children will be really hungry when they get home because they have been running around all afternoon without any food.
- Why don't you come round at 9 o'clock? The children will be going to bed at that time so it will be nice and peaceful.
- I will not go to speak to her until she apologizes.
- Martin asked me if I would help him with English.
- We will have driven over five hundred kilometers by the time we reach the border.
- You will be sick if you eat more chocolate.
- Look out! We are going to hit the car in front.
- Don't phone too early because I will be putting the baby to bed.
- By the time I qualify, I will have been studying law for six years.
- He was not quite sure when his parents would come home.
- Bob didn't know if the time-table for the next week would change.
- By the time you get back, all the food will have gone.
- You will not be able to enter the building if you do not have your identity card.
- The doctor told Carol that a week in the country would make her feel better.
- When I learn a thousand English words, will I be able to read a newspaper?
- We will return the reference material to the check-out desk after we have examined it.
- Tom promised that he would phone us again at the weekend.
- The film probably will not finish until midnight.
- We were anxious if the police would find the criminal.
- Hopefully she will be cooking dinner for us by the time we get home.
- I'm sure if we don't get there before seven, they will have eaten and drunk everything.
- I hope you will not forget your promise by tomorrow.
- Will you see Nick tomorrow by any chance?
- I'm sure you will have recovered by then from the shock of meeting Jason here.
- I will stay up late tonight to watch a film on television.
- By Christmas I will have been working in this office for ten years.
- A new video shop is opening today. I am meeting my friends there this afternoon.
В каждом предложении мы определили, какое будущее время использовать, основываясь на контексте и временных указателях. Например, "will" используется для простых предсказаний, а "will have" для действий, которые завершатся к определенному моменту в будущем. Если у вас остались вопросы, не стесняйтесь спрашивать!
